How much do senior java software developer jobs pay per hour?

As of Jul 18, 2026, the average hourly pay for senior java software developer in Downingtown, PA is $65.15, according to ZipRecruiter salary data. Most workers in this role earn between $57.07 and $72.79 per hour, depending on experience, location, and employer.

What is a Senior Java Software Developer?

A Senior Java Software Developer is an experienced professional responsible for designing, developing, and maintaining complex software applications using the Java programming language. They typically lead development teams, mentor junior developers, and contribute to architectural decisions. Senior Java Developers are expected to have a deep understanding of Java frameworks, best coding practices, and software development methodologies. They also collaborate with stakeholders to deliver robust, scalable, and efficient software solutions.

What are some common challenges Senior Java Software Developers face when leading projects, and how can they effectively address them?

Senior Java Software Developers often encounter challenges such as balancing hands-on coding with mentoring junior team members, managing project timelines, and ensuring code quality across large, distributed systems. To address these, it’s crucial to establish clear communication channels, implement robust code review processes, and leverage agile methodologies for project management. Additionally, staying up-to-date with the latest Java frameworks and best practices helps in making informed architectural decisions and streamlining development workflows.

What are the key skills and qualifications needed to thrive as a Senior Java Software Developer, and why are they important?

To thrive as a Senior Java Software Developer, you need advanced proficiency in Java programming, strong knowledge of software design patterns, and experience with frameworks like Spring, typically backed by a bachelor's degree in computer science or a related field. Familiarity with tools such as Git, Maven, Jenkins, and cloud platforms, along with relevant certifications like Oracle Certified Professional Java SE, is often required. Strong problem-solving abilities, effective communication, and leadership skills help in mentoring teams and collaborating on complex projects. These skills ensure the delivery of robust, scalable software solutions and foster innovation within development teams.

What is the difference between Senior Java Software Developer vs Java Software Engineer?

AspectSenior Java Software DeveloperJava Software Engineer
Required CredentialsBachelor's degree in Computer Science or related field; extensive Java experience; certifications like Oracle Java CertificationBachelor's degree in Computer Science or related field; Java programming skills; certifications are common but not mandatory
Work EnvironmentDevelops complex applications, mentors junior staff, leads projectsDesigns and develops Java applications, collaborates with teams, implements features
Employer & Industry UsageUsed across tech companies, finance, healthcare, and enterprise sectorsCommon in software development firms, IT departments, and tech startups

The main difference between a Senior Java Software Developer and a Java Software Engineer lies in experience level and responsibilities. Senior developers often lead projects and mentor others, while Java Software Engineers focus on designing and implementing Java applications. Both roles require strong Java skills and similar educational backgrounds, but seniority involves additional leadership and project management duties.

Job Title: Senior Java / Platform Reliability Engineer
Location: Malvern, PA
Duration: Long-term Contract
 
Job Description
We are seeking a strong Senior 10+ Years of Java / Platform Reliability Engineer with solid software engineering experience and a strong understanding of production reliability. This role is not a traditional operations-focused SRE position. The ideal candidate should be a hands-on backend engineer who can design, build, and support resilient, scalable, and fault-tolerant applications in a cloud environment.
The role will focus on backend platform engineering, reliability improvements, cloud integration, observability, automation, and supporting production systems. The candidate should have strong experience in Java development, along with working knowledge of Python, AWS, APIs, microservices, and cloud-native application support.
 
Key Responsibilities
Design, develop, and enhance backend services using Java and related backend technologies.
Build reliable, scalable, and fault-tolerant applications that can operate in production at scale.
Work closely with platform, application, and infrastructure teams to improve system reliability and performance.
Support production systems by identifying reliability gaps, performance issues, and areas for automation.
Develop and maintain microservices, APIs, and backend integrations.
Work with AWS cloud services to support application deployment, monitoring, and platform improvements.
Use Python or scripting where needed for automation, tooling, and reliability engineering tasks.
Contribute to incident analysis, root cause reviews, and long-term preventive solutions.
Improve observability through logging, metrics, tracing, dashboards, and alerting.
Collaborate with engineering teams to implement best practices around resiliency, scalability, and availability.
Participate in design discussions for backend systems, cloud architecture, and platform reliability.
Help modernize and improve existing applications with better monitoring, automation, and fault tolerance.
 
Required Skills
10+ years of overall software engineering experience.
Strong hands-on experience with Java development.
Experience building and supporting backend services, APIs, and microservices.
Good experience with AWS/cloud technologies.
Working knowledge of Python for scripting, automation, or backend support.
Strong understanding of production reliability, scalability, and system performance.
Experience operating applications in production environments.
Knowledge of resilient application design, fault tolerance, retries, timeouts, failover, and recovery patterns.
Experience with CI/CD pipelines and modern software delivery practices.
Strong troubleshooting and problem-solving skills.
Ability to work with cross-functional teams including development, platform, cloud, and infrastructure teams.
 
Preferred Skills
Experience with telemetry and observability tools such as OpenTelemetry, Splunk, Datadog, CloudWatch, Grafana, Prometheus, or similar tools.
Experience with distributed tracing, logging, metrics, and alerting.
Knowledge of container platforms such as Docker and Kubernetes.
Experience with infrastructure automation or platform engineering tools.
Exposure to event-driven architecture or messaging systems.
Prior experience in a Site Reliability Engineering, Platform Engineering, or Production Engineering role.
